Annette McLendon, age 75, passed from her earthly life on July 22, 2015. She was preceded in death by her husband, Robert L. McLendon, and her parents, Clarence and Lucille Hill. She leaves to mourn her passing her daughter and son-in-law, Amy and Shea Thomas; and her grandchildren, Logan and Laura Riley Thomas, of Huntsville; her brother, Richard Hill (Emily) of Ocean Springs, MS; sisters-in-law, Frankie Tolbert (Jerry) of Rainbow City, AL, and Kay Ellison (Dan) of Gadsden; and several nieces and nephews.

Funeral service will be on Sunday, July 26, 2015 at Laughlin Service Funeral Home in Huntsville, with visitation beginning at 2 p.m. and the service at 3 p.m. with Rev. Coy Hallmark officiating. Burial will follow at Maple Hill Cemetery.

Annette is fondly remembered by many friends and associates. She influenced numerous lives in the 31 years she taught in the Huntsville school system. In her retirement years she enjoyed the activity of line dancing at the Senior Center where she developed lasting friendships, participation in the Senior group at Crestwood Hospital where she served a term on the board of directors, and membership in the Widows and Widowers of Alabama group which she was instrumental in helping develop. She was a member of First United Methodist Church of Huntsville.
